Scottish author John Buchan (1875-1940) was both an acclaimed writer of adventure novels and, as the Governor General of Canada, one of the most high-ranking colonial administrators in the British Empire. His political career usually took precedence over his writing, but he still managed to produce several iconic works of spy fi ction, including his masterpiece The Thirty-Nine Steps.
